Here's the armorer skill trainers you can find:

Armorer Training

Low Level Trainers: Eitar who is located east of Leyawiin’s great Chapel of Zenithar and Tadrose Helas and the Bravil Fighters Guild

Medium Level Trainers: Rohsaan is located at the A Fighting Chance store in the Imperial City’s Market and Rasheda at the Fire and Steel in Chorrol

Master Level Trainers: Gin-Wulm at The Best Defense in the Imperial City’s Market District but wanders the Market and Elven Garden Districts


And the armorer skill books:

     Armorer
         Heavy Armor Repair - loot
         Light Armor Repair - Bravil
         The Armorer's Challenge - Cheydinhal, Imperial City
         Cherim's Heart of Anequina - Imperial City
         Last Scabbard of Akrash - Imperial City
